WebLeaving the skin on a chicken while you cook it will make your meat juicer and more flavorful. Unsaturated Fats Chicken skin contains a high amount of healthy unsaturated fat. In 1oz of chicken skin, there is a total fat content of 8.1g. This is made up of 2.3g of saturated fat, 3.4g of monounsaturated fat, and 1.7g of polyunsaturated fat.
